UPPER BODY
For some reason, my upper body isn’t as dry as my lower body, so it needs less moisture. On my upper half I use Fake Bake’s Flawless spray. This spray is the bomb diggity! It’s lightweight, so easy to apply (the colour guide is fab and washes off once you shower) and smells deliciously like coconuts. I simply spritz some on the body mitt provided and apply in circular motions to my arms, torso and back. If you use a mitt to apply your self tan, be sure to put a pair of gloves on first underneath the mitt. Fakebake comes with a mitt and a pair of gloves! Genius. The gloves ensure that the mitt stays in place. Also, no prospect of orange hands. The solution dries in a flash and I can get dressed 20 minutes after I apply it. The next day, the colour is a completely believable gorgeous brown colour. The undertone is green so the colour never looks orange. I love it the most and there’s nothing I don’t like about it. LOWER BODY
My lower body (as you know now) is dry come the colder months. Because it has been formulated for dry skin, I chose Fake Bake’s Body Butter. Best decision ever. First off, the body butter looks like chocolate. It’s a thick brown butter that I apply using the gloves provided. I rub it into my legs, starting at my ankles, in circular motions and I’m done. It couldn’t be easier. I finish my feet off using Dove’s Summer Glow Body Lotion because I don’t want tell-tale unbelievably brown feet. The colour is gorgeous, believable and perfect!

• Because the gloves provided ultimately give way from wear and tear get yourself a box of gloves from Dis-Chem. They work out cheaper if you buy in bulk versus buying them separately.
• Always, always, always moisturise your elbows, knees and feet before applying self tanner and avoid shaving your legs while you’re rocking your self tan (shaving is like exfoliating and can render your gorgeous glow patchy).
